Shah Rukh Khan and Rajinikanth fans are eagerly waiting to see them on-screen together after the 2011 film Ra.One. After Rajinikanth made a guest appearance as Chitti in the film, SRK is all set to have a cameo in Jailer 2. Now, as per reports, SRK will join the film's final shooting schedule to shoot for his cameo.
SRK to join Jailer 2's final shooting schedule for cameoIt was last year when fans heard about Shah Rukh Khan's cameo in Jailer 2. While Mithun Chakraborty had already dropped a hint last year, in 2026, Mohanlal’s stylist, Jishad Shamsudeen confirmed the cameo.
As per a report by Cinema Express, while Rajinikanth has completed filming for Jailer 2, Shah Rukh Khan's scenes are yet to be filmed. Latest reports reveal that SRK will join the shooting in the final schedule and will complete his portions for the cameo. The actor is expected to wrap up the shoot in 7-8 days.

The Nelson directorial will see Rajinikanth reprise his role as ‘Tiger’ Muthuvel Pandian.
Earlier the director had shared the teaser on X and wrote, “Immensely happy to announce my next film Jailer 2 with the one and only Superstar Thalaivar Rajinikanth sir and with my favourite Sun Pictures Kalanithimaran sir and my dearest loving friend Anirudh and thanks to my team K Vijay Kartik, Nirmalcuts, Kiran, Pallavi Singh, Chethan, Kabilan Chelliah Suren.”

Last year, Mithun Chakraborty spoke to Siti Cinema about his role in Jailer 2 and had revealed details of SRK's cameo, “My next is Jailer 2, where everybody is against me. Rajinikanth, Mohanlal, Shah Rukh Khan, Ramya Krishnan, Shiva Rajkumar, all their characters are against me.”
He also seemed to leak that he plays the film’s antagonist while saying this.
As per a report by Cinema Express, while Rajinikanth initially announced June 12 as the film's release date, new speculations suggest the film will only hit theatres on August 12. The makers are yet to confirm the same. The film reportedly stars Mohanlal, Shivarajkumar, Vijay Sethupathi, S.J. Suryah, Santhanam, Suraj Venjaramoodu, and Vidya Balan.
